Experiments (use with caution):
· instrumentationHook
✓ Starting...
It looks like you're trying to use TypeScript but do not have the required package(s) installed.
Installing dependencies
If you are not trying to use TypeScript, please remove the tsconfig.json file from your package root (and any TypeScript files in your pages directory).
Installing devDependencies (yarn):
typescript
@types/react
@types/node
[1/4] Resolving packages...
[2/4] Fetching packages...
warning Pattern ["@types/react@18.3.4"] is trying to unpack in the same destination "C:\Users\itkom\scoop\apps\yarn\current\cache\v6\npm-@types-react-18.3.4-dfdd534a1d081307144c00e325c06e00312c93a3-integrity\node_modules\@types\react" as pattern ["@types/react@","@types/react@"]. This could result in non-deterministic behavior, skipping.
warning Pattern ["@types/node@22.5.1"] is trying to unpack in the same destination "C:\Users\itkom\scoop\apps\yarn\current\cache\v6\npm-@types-node-22.5.1-de01dce265f6b99ed32b295962045d10b5b99560-integrity\node_modules\@types\node" as pattern ["@types/node@","@types/node@","@types/node@","@types/node@","@types/node@","@types/node@","@types/node@*"]. This could result in non-deterministic behavior, skipping.
[3/4] Linking dependencies...
warning "@sentry/nextjs > @opentelemetry/instrumentation-http@0.52.1" has unmet peer dependency "@opentelemetry/api@^1.3.0".
warning "@sentry/nextjs > @sentry/opentelemetry@8.27.0" has unmet peer dependency "@opentelemetry/api@^1.9.0".
warning "@sentry/nextjs > @sentry/opentelemetry@8.27.0" has unmet peer dependency "@opentelemetry/core@^1.25.1".
warning "@sentry/nextjs > @sentry/opentelemetry@8.27.0" has unmet peer dependency "@opentelemetry/instrumentation@^0.52.1".
warning "@sentry/nextjs > @sentry/opentelemetry@8.27.0" has unmet peer dependency "@opentelemetry/sdk-trace-base@^1.25.1".
warning "@sentry/nextjs > @sentry/webpack-plugin@2.20.1" has unmet peer dependency "webpack@>=4.40.0".
warning "@sentry/nextjs > @opentelemetry/instrumentation-http > @opentelemetry/core@1.25.1" has unmet peer dependency "@opentelemetry/api@>=1.0.0 <1.10.0".
warning "@sentry/nextjs > @opentelemetry/instrumentation-http > @opentelemetry/instrumentation@0.52.1" has unmet peer dependency "@opentelemetry/api@^1.3.0".
warning " > @tiptap/extension-document@2.6.6" has unmet peer dependency "@tiptap/core@^2.6.6".
warning " > @tiptap/extension-hard-break@2.6.6" has unmet peer dependency "@tiptap/core@^2.6.6".
warning " > @tiptap/extension-highlight@2.6.6" has unmet peer dependency "@tiptap/core@^2.6.6".
warning " > @tiptap/extension-paragraph@2.6.6" has unmet peer dependency "@tiptap/core@^2.6.6".
warning " > @tiptap/extension-placeholder@2.6.6" has unmet peer dependency "@tiptap/core@^2.6.6".
warning " > @tiptap/extension-text@2.6.6" has unmet peer dependency "@tiptap/core@^2.6.6".
warning " > @tiptap/react@2.6.6" has unmet peer dependency "@tiptap/core@^2.6.6".
warning "@tiptap/react > @tiptap/extension-bubble-menu@2.6.6" has unmet peer dependency "@tiptap/core@^2.6.6".
warning "@tiptap/react > @tiptap/extension-floating-menu@2.6.6" has unmet peer dependency "@tiptap/core@^2.6.6".
warning "tiptap > tiptap-utils > prosemirror-utils@0.6.7" has incorrect peer dependency "prosemirror-tables@^0.6.5".
[4/4] Building fresh packages...
warning Error running install script for optional dependency: "R:\llmchat\node_modules\canvas: Command failed.
Exit code: 7
Command: node-pre-gyp install --fallback-to-build --update-binary
Arguments:
Directory: R:\llmchat\node_modules\canvas
Output:
node-pre-gyp info it worked if it ends with ok
node-pre-gyp info using node-pre-gyp@1.0.11
node-pre-gyp info using node@22.7.0 | win32 | x64
(node:20884) [DEP0040] DeprecationWarning: The punycode module is deprecated. Please use a userland alternative instead.
(Use node --trace-deprecation ... to show where the warning was created)
node-pre-gyp http GET https://github.com/Automattic/node-canvas/releases/download/v2.11.2/canvas-v2.11.2-node-v127-win32-unknown-x64.tar.gz
node-pre-gyp ERR! install response status 404 Not Found on https://github.com/Automattic/node-canvas/releases/download/v2.11.2/canvas-v2.11.2-node-v127-win32-unknown-x64.tar.gz
node-pre-gyp WARN Pre-built binaries not installable for canvas@2.11.2 and node@22.7.0 (node-v127 ABI, unknown) (falling back to source compile with node-gyp)
node-pre-gyp WARN Hit error response status 404 Not Found on https://github.com/Automattic/node-canvas/releases/download/v2.11.2/canvas-v2.11.2-node-v127-win32-unknown-x64.tar.gz
node-pre-gyp ERR! UNCAUGHT EXCEPTION
node-pre-gyp ERR! stack Error: spawn EINVAL
node-pre-gyp ERR! stack at ChildProcess.spawn (node:internal/child_process:421:11)
node-pre-gyp ERR! stack at Object.spawn (node:child_process:761:9)
node-pre-gyp ERR! stack at module.exports.run_gyp (R:\llmchat\node_modules\@mapbox\node-pre-gyp\lib\util\compile.js:80:18)
node-pre-gyp ERR! stack at build (R:\llmchat\node_modules\@mapbox\node-pre-gyp\lib\build.js:41:13)
node-pre-gyp ERR! stack at self.commands. [as build] (R:\llmchat\node_modules\@mapbox\node-pre-gyp\lib\node-pre-gyp.js:86:37)
node-pre-gyp ERR! stack at run (R:\llmchat\node_modules\@mapbox\node-pre-gyp\lib\main.js:81:30)
node-pre-gyp ERR! stack at process.processTicksAndRejections (node:internal/process/task_queues:85:11)
node-pre-gyp ERR! System Windows_NT 10.0.22631
node-pre-gyp ERR! command \"C:\\Users\\itkom\\scoop\\apps\\nodejs\\current\\node.exe\" \"R:\\llmchat\\node_modules\\@mapbox\\node-pre-gyp\\bin\\node-pre-gyp\" \"install\" \"--fallback-to-build\" \"--update-binary\"
node-pre-gyp ERR! cwd R:\llmchat\node_modules\canvas
node-pre-gyp ERR! node -v v22.7.0
node-pre-gyp ERR! node-pre-gyp -v v1.0.11"
info This module is OPTIONAL, you can safely ignore this error
success Saved lockfile.
success Saved 3 new dependencies.
info Direct dependencies
├─ @types/node@22.5.1
├─ @types/react@18.3.4
└─ typescript@5.5.4
info All dependencies
├─ @types/node@22.5.1
├─ @types/react@18.3.4
└─ typescript@5.5.4
$ husky
TypeError: Cannot read properties of undefined (reading 'endsWith')
at mod.require (R:\llmchat\node_modules\next\dist\server\require-hook.js:62:17)
at require (node:internal/modules/helpers:126:16)
at verifyTypeScriptSetup (R:\llmchat\node_modules\next\dist\lib\verify-typescript-setup.js:116:42)
at async verifyTypeScript (R:\llmchat\node_modules\next\dist\server\lib\router-utils\setup-dev-bundler.js:112:26)
at async startWatcher (R:\llmchat\node_modules\next\dist\server\lib\router-utils\setup-dev-bundler.js:139:29)
at async setupDevBundler (R:\llmchat\node_modules\next\dist\server\lib\router-utils\setup-dev-bundler.js:775:20)
at async Span.traceAsyncFn (R:\llmchat\node_modules\next\dist\trace\trace.js:154:20)
at async initialize (R:\llmchat\node_modules\next\dist\server\lib\router-server.js:78:30)
at async Server. (R:\llmchat\node_modules\next\dist\server\lib\start-server.js:249:36)
OS Windows 11.
git clone https://github.com/trendy-design/llmchat.git cd llmchat yarn install
yarn dev
yarn run v1.22.22 $ next dev ▲ Next.js 14.2.3
Experiments (use with caution): · instrumentationHook
✓ Starting... It looks like you're trying to use TypeScript but do not have the required package(s) installed. Installing dependencies
If you are not trying to use TypeScript, please remove the tsconfig.json file from your package root (and any TypeScript files in your pages directory).
Installing devDependencies (yarn):
[1/4] Resolving packages... [2/4] Fetching packages... warning Pattern ["@types/react@18.3.4"] is trying to unpack in the same destination "C:\Users\itkom\scoop\apps\yarn\current\cache\v6\npm-@types-react-18.3.4-dfdd534a1d081307144c00e325c06e00312c93a3-integrity\node_modules\@types\react" as pattern ["@types/react@","@types/react@"]. This could result in non-deterministic behavior, skipping. warning Pattern ["@types/node@22.5.1"] is trying to unpack in the same destination "C:\Users\itkom\scoop\apps\yarn\current\cache\v6\npm-@types-node-22.5.1-de01dce265f6b99ed32b295962045d10b5b99560-integrity\node_modules\@types\node" as pattern ["@types/node@","@types/node@","@types/node@","@types/node@","@types/node@","@types/node@","@types/node@*"]. This could result in non-deterministic behavior, skipping. [3/4] Linking dependencies... warning "@sentry/nextjs > @opentelemetry/instrumentation-http@0.52.1" has unmet peer dependency "@opentelemetry/api@^1.3.0". warning "@sentry/nextjs > @sentry/opentelemetry@8.27.0" has unmet peer dependency "@opentelemetry/api@^1.9.0". warning "@sentry/nextjs > @sentry/opentelemetry@8.27.0" has unmet peer dependency "@opentelemetry/core@^1.25.1". warning "@sentry/nextjs > @sentry/opentelemetry@8.27.0" has unmet peer dependency "@opentelemetry/instrumentation@^0.52.1". warning "@sentry/nextjs > @sentry/opentelemetry@8.27.0" has unmet peer dependency "@opentelemetry/sdk-trace-base@^1.25.1". warning "@sentry/nextjs > @sentry/webpack-plugin@2.20.1" has unmet peer dependency "webpack@>=4.40.0". warning "@sentry/nextjs > @opentelemetry/instrumentation-http > @opentelemetry/core@1.25.1" has unmet peer dependency "@opentelemetry/api@>=1.0.0 <1.10.0". warning "@sentry/nextjs > @opentelemetry/instrumentation-http > @opentelemetry/instrumentation@0.52.1" has unmet peer dependency "@opentelemetry/api@^1.3.0". warning " > @tiptap/extension-document@2.6.6" has unmet peer dependency "@tiptap/core@^2.6.6". warning " > @tiptap/extension-hard-break@2.6.6" has unmet peer dependency "@tiptap/core@^2.6.6". warning " > @tiptap/extension-highlight@2.6.6" has unmet peer dependency "@tiptap/core@^2.6.6". warning " > @tiptap/extension-paragraph@2.6.6" has unmet peer dependency "@tiptap/core@^2.6.6". warning " > @tiptap/extension-placeholder@2.6.6" has unmet peer dependency "@tiptap/core@^2.6.6". warning " > @tiptap/extension-text@2.6.6" has unmet peer dependency "@tiptap/core@^2.6.6". warning " > @tiptap/react@2.6.6" has unmet peer dependency "@tiptap/core@^2.6.6". warning "@tiptap/react > @tiptap/extension-bubble-menu@2.6.6" has unmet peer dependency "@tiptap/core@^2.6.6". warning "@tiptap/react > @tiptap/extension-floating-menu@2.6.6" has unmet peer dependency "@tiptap/core@^2.6.6". warning "tiptap > tiptap-utils > prosemirror-utils@0.6.7" has incorrect peer dependency "prosemirror-tables@^0.6.5". [4/4] Building fresh packages... warning Error running install script for optional dependency: "R:\llmchat\node_modules\canvas: Command failed. Exit code: 7 Command: node-pre-gyp install --fallback-to-build --update-binary Arguments: Directory: R:\llmchat\node_modules\canvas Output: node-pre-gyp info it worked if it ends with ok node-pre-gyp info using node-pre-gyp@1.0.11 node-pre-gyp info using node@22.7.0 | win32 | x64 (node:20884) [DEP0040] DeprecationWarning: The [as build] (R:\llmchat\node_modules\@mapbox\node-pre-gyp\lib\node-pre-gyp.js:86:37)
node-pre-gyp ERR! stack at run (R:\llmchat\node_modules\@mapbox\node-pre-gyp\lib\main.js:81:30)
node-pre-gyp ERR! stack at process.processTicksAndRejections (node:internal/process/task_queues:85:11)
node-pre-gyp ERR! System Windows_NT 10.0.22631
node-pre-gyp ERR! command \"C:\\Users\\itkom\\scoop\\apps\\nodejs\\current\\node.exe\" \"R:\\llmchat\\node_modules\\@mapbox\\node-pre-gyp\\bin\\node-pre-gyp\" \"install\" \"--fallback-to-build\" \"--update-binary\"
node-pre-gyp ERR! cwd R:\llmchat\node_modules\canvas
node-pre-gyp ERR! node -v v22.7.0
node-pre-gyp ERR! node-pre-gyp -v v1.0.11"
info This module is OPTIONAL, you can safely ignore this error
success Saved lockfile.
success Saved 3 new dependencies.
info Direct dependencies
├─ @types/node@22.5.1
├─ @types/react@18.3.4
└─ typescript@5.5.4
info All dependencies
├─ @types/node@22.5.1
├─ @types/react@18.3.4
└─ typescript@5.5.4
$ husky
punycode
module is deprecated. Please use a userland alternative instead. (Usenode --trace-deprecation ...
to show where the warning was created) node-pre-gyp http GET https://github.com/Automattic/node-canvas/releases/download/v2.11.2/canvas-v2.11.2-node-v127-win32-unknown-x64.tar.gz node-pre-gyp ERR! install response status 404 Not Found on https://github.com/Automattic/node-canvas/releases/download/v2.11.2/canvas-v2.11.2-node-v127-win32-unknown-x64.tar.gz node-pre-gyp WARN Pre-built binaries not installable for canvas@2.11.2 and node@22.7.0 (node-v127 ABI, unknown) (falling back to source compile with node-gyp) node-pre-gyp WARN Hit error response status 404 Not Found on https://github.com/Automattic/node-canvas/releases/download/v2.11.2/canvas-v2.11.2-node-v127-win32-unknown-x64.tar.gz node-pre-gyp ERR! UNCAUGHT EXCEPTION node-pre-gyp ERR! stack Error: spawn EINVAL node-pre-gyp ERR! stack at ChildProcess.spawn (node:internal/child_process:421:11) node-pre-gyp ERR! stack at Object.spawn (node:child_process:761:9) node-pre-gyp ERR! stack at module.exports.run_gyp (R:\llmchat\node_modules\@mapbox\node-pre-gyp\lib\util\compile.js:80:18) node-pre-gyp ERR! stack at build (R:\llmchat\node_modules\@mapbox\node-pre-gyp\lib\build.js:41:13) node-pre-gyp ERR! stack at self.commands.TypeError: Cannot read properties of undefined (reading 'endsWith') at mod.require (R:\llmchat\node_modules\next\dist\server\require-hook.js:62:17) at require (node:internal/modules/helpers:126:16) at verifyTypeScriptSetup (R:\llmchat\node_modules\next\dist\lib\verify-typescript-setup.js:116:42) at async verifyTypeScript (R:\llmchat\node_modules\next\dist\server\lib\router-utils\setup-dev-bundler.js:112:26) at async startWatcher (R:\llmchat\node_modules\next\dist\server\lib\router-utils\setup-dev-bundler.js:139:29) at async setupDevBundler (R:\llmchat\node_modules\next\dist\server\lib\router-utils\setup-dev-bundler.js:775:20) at async Span.traceAsyncFn (R:\llmchat\node_modules\next\dist\trace\trace.js:154:20) at async initialize (R:\llmchat\node_modules\next\dist\server\lib\router-server.js:78:30) at async Server. (R:\llmchat\node_modules\next\dist\server\lib\start-server.js:249:36)
Done in 8.58s.